Near-Range Radar are radar systems operating around a car when in motion to detect possible impacts with obstacles, such as other cars, walls, pedestrians, etc. so that safety measures may be triggered automatically, such as pre-tensioning of seat belts and inflating airbags.

The global key companies of Near Range Lidar include Hesai Tech, Robo Sense, Beijing LiangDao Automotive Technology, LeiShen Intelligence System, Continental, Velodyne, Ouster, Cepton, WHST, Beijing Yijing Technology, etc. In 2024, the global five largest players hold a share approximately % in terms of revenue.
